Lessons and observations as a 911 Emergency Paramedic in rural America. This book shows the challenges of dealing with difficult medical emergencies in austere environments with very little help to safely treat and transport vulnerable patients. This book is for those considering a career in the Emergency Medical Service and those wanting to prepare for the difficult yet rewarding field of 911 Ambulance service. This book is also about considerations that make up great EMS organizations, and those areas that could potentially make the difference from retaining or losing great EMS employees.
